Equality Minister Responds After Homophobic Comments Flood Pride Announcement

After the announcement for Malta Pride, a number of homophobic responses flooded the comment section, criticising the need for such events.
A Maltese resident who is part of the LGBTQIA+ community took to social media to express her shock at all the homophobia.
"We live somewhere that has made incredible progress. We love Malta so much! But we're not going to become complacent just because the law got there before everyone's attitudes did," she explained.
Minister for Equality and Civil Rights Rosianne Cutajar also commented on the situation, stating that this situation "helps you understand why pride is still so important."
"Equality is not a sector where we can stay comfortable and say we've done enough," continued Cutajar, "It is dynamic work where you need to keep responding to the realities of the day and the experiences of people."
"Pride remains important," emphasised Rosianne Cutajar.
